Navigating Aluminium Bifold Door Repairs: A Comprehensive Guide
Aluminium bifold doors have become a popular choice for property owners due to their sleek style, sturdiness, and energy effectiveness. Nevertheless, like any other home fixture, these doors can experience concerns with time that need repair. This short article provides a comprehensive guide on how to attend to common problems with aluminium bifold doors, where to discover reliable repair services, and what to expect throughout the repair process.
Understanding Aluminium Bifold Doors
Aluminium bifold doors are made from light-weight yet sturdy aluminium frames, which are developed to move and fold nicely to one side, maximizing area and providing unobstructed views. These doors are typically utilized in modern-day homes, particularly in locations like outdoor patios, balconies, and living spaces. They are known for their resistance to rust, low maintenance requirements, and capability to endure numerous weather.

Typical Issues and DIY Solutions
Before calling a professional, it’s helpful to recognize and try to deal with some typical issues with aluminium bifold doors. Here are a few issues you might come across and how to address them:
-
Sticky or Jammed Doors
- Trigger: Dirt, debris, or misalignment.
- Solution: Clean the tracks with a wet fabric and a moderate cleaning agent. Use a lube like silicone spray to guarantee smooth motion. If the door is jammed, look for misalignment and change the hinges or rollers.
-
Dripping Doors
- Cause: Damaged or used seals.
- Solution: Inspect the seals around the door and replace any that are damaged or used. Guarantee the seals are effectively installed and compressed to develop a tight seal.
-
Squeaky Hinges
- Cause: Lack of lubrication.
- Option: Apply a lubricant like WD-40 to the hinges. Rub out any excess to avoid dirt build-up.
-
Broken or Loose Handles
- Cause: Wear and tear or incorrect installation.
- Service: Tighten loose screws or replace the handle if it is harmed. Make sure the brand-new manage works with your door.
-
Dented or Scratched Frames
- Cause: Accidental damage.
- Solution: For small damages, use a hairdryer to heat up the area and gently press the dent out. For scratches, utilize a metal polish or a specialized scratch eliminator.
When to Call a Professional
While some concerns can be fixed with DIY solutions, more complex problems might need the knowledge of a professional. Here are some signs that it’s time to call a repair service:
- Severe Misalignment: If the door is significantly out of alignment and you can not change it yourself.
- Structural Damage: If the frame or panels are cracked or broken.
- Complex Mechanisms: If the rollers, hinges, or locking systems are malfunctioning and you are not confident in your ability to repair them.
- Warranty Issues: If the door is under service warranty, it’s finest to call the manufacturer or a licensed professional to avoid voiding the service warranty.

FAQs
Q: How much does it cost to repair an aluminium bifold door?
- The cost can vary depending on the level of the damage and the parts needed. Basic repairs like lubing hinges may cost as little as ₤ 50, while more intricate repairs including structural damage can range from ₤ 200 to ₤ 500 or more.
Q: Can I repair an aluminium bifold door myself?
- Yes, for minor issues like sticky doors or squeaky hinges, you can often perform the repairs yourself. However, for more intricate issues, it’s best to consult a professional.
Q: How long do aluminium bifold doors last?
- With appropriate maintenance, aluminium bifold doors can last 20 to 30 years. Regular cleansing and lubrication can extend their lifespan.
Q: How frequently should I maintain my aluminium bifold door?
- It’s recommended to tidy and examine your aluminium bifold door a minimum of twice a year. Lube the hinges and tracks as required to make sure smooth operation.
